Drowning in Waste – Case Luanda, Angola
Mulenvos Landfill is the largest landfill in Angola. It is loed in the Municipality of Viana 12 km in the west part of Luanda and has been in operation since December 2007. Thousands of children are either living on the landfill property, or rely on it as a source of income. Enhanced Landfill Mining (ELFM) is defined as "the safe exploration, conditioning, excavation and integrated valorisation of (historic, present and/or future) landfilled waste streams as both materials (WastetoMaterial) and energy (WastetoEnergy), using innovative transformation technologies and respecting the most stringent social and ecological criteria" (Jones et al, 2013).
